The Pink Diamond Revue – “Go Go Girl” premiere

The Pink Diamond Revue exist in a world outside of ours; a three piece project from outer-space via Reading, they create a truly unique mixture of heady electro and vintage blues. After perfecting their experiments across the UKs seediest basement bars, the team are now ready to release ‘Go Go Girl’ unto their unsuspected public, destined to be met with envious eyes.

Fronted by their leader Acid Dol (a model from another dimension), PDR combine beats from today with riffs, samples and vocal harmonies from the 50’s and 60’s. Fearlessly active, they’ve clocked over 150 live shows in their brief time here since landing in 2014.

The band use strictly vintage gear, from 70s synths rescued from the rubbish to old guitars. ‘Go Go Girl’ was written on a 1960 EKO and there are no pre-sets on the analogue equipment they use making every performance completely unique.
